Gemma Collins is getting married on the advice of her astrologer
Gemma Collins is getting married next year on the advice of her astrologer. The 44-year-old reality star has been engaged to Rami Hawash for four years and will finally walk down the aisle in 2016 after looking for signs in the stars. She told the Mirror: "Absolutely it will be 2026. I spoke to my astrologer and that is the year to get married." However, Gemma admitted she has done very little to plan her wedding, which won't be a low-key affair, and hasn't even settled on a location as yet. Discussing wedding planning, she said: "It's going really well but, if I'm honest, I haven't actually done anything about it yet because I've had just the craziest of times recently. Gemma Collins makes sweet confession about being a stepmum to her fiancé Rami Hawash's son Tristan, seven, after revealing wedding details
Gemma Collins has made a sweet confession about being a stepmum to her partner Rami Hawash's son Tristan as she spoke candidly in a new interview on Sunday. The former TOWIE star is fully involved in life of her fiancé Rami's, 50, son who is now seven years old. In a new interview this weekend she told how this summer she has been looking after him amid the school holidays and instead of going on lavish trips abroad has been focused on 'being a stepmum'. She told The Mirror: 'I've been busy being a step mum, because obviously I've got Tristan now. We've been just doing family, normal, kiddy, friendly things.' 'I spent more time in [children's trampoline park] Jump Street than I've had hot dinners. I've been on the PlayStation, you name it, I been doing it. 'Parks, doggy walks, I just been being a step mum to be honest. I wish I could say to you, I'm sat in Mykonos drinking a Pina Colada, but I'm not. I have been being stepmother duties but I wouldn't have it any other way. I've loved it.' She said she was fully enjoying the summer holidays and was making the most of it all as 'time is precious'. It comes after Gemma finally confirmed her wedding plans – and has revealed she aims to make it bigger than Jeff Bezos and Lauren Sanchez 's $50 million extravaganza. The TOWIE legend, 44, said she and fiancé Rami will wed in 2026, after being told by her astrologer it was the perfect year to get hitched. The pair got engaged for the second time four years ago, and Gemma admitted the countdown was officially on – even if the planning hasn't quite gone to schedule. She confessed she hadn't booked the venue yet and could even leave the finer details until the last minute, but promised the bash would be magical. Gemma went on to explain that she wanted a woodland theme with a fairytale twist, inspired by her love of Disney's Maleficent and was hoping for a 'mythical and boho' atmosphere. She added that Irish twin singers Jedward could help to bring the fantasy vision to life and she would have a starring role when she ties the knot. Gemma and Jedward have been friends for years with the Irish twins - who first found fame on The X Factor - regularly travelling to Essex to see her. They even spent Christmas and New Year together two years ago. Rami got down on one knee in the Maldives, after whisking Gemma off on a birthday holiday, which she admits took her completely by surprise. He planned a romantic sushi dinner before telling her to look out the window, where he laid lights on the beach that read: 'Will you marry me?' Rami set up an outdoor seating area and flew out hundreds of roses so petals could cover the sands where they were sitting, with the ring in a shell. Gemma gushed that it was 'beautiful' and admitted she 'had no idea' what was coming and didn't have any makeup on or even a bra, but added: 'I wouldn't change a thing.' Rami popped the question with a huge diamond ring, that The Daily Mail revealed is worth in excess of a staggering £200,000. Gemma has known Rami for over ten years after meeting the businessman back in 2011 and they have been engaged twice before. He had originally proposed by placing the ring in a Christmas pudding in 2013 when they first start dating. However, four weeks later, Gemma had called off the engagement. But the pair then reunited during lockdown, seven years after breaking off their original engagement.
